Horizontal wells are not suitable for bottom water reservoir development
Online published: 2007-09-15
The adaptability of horizontal wells for bottom water reservoirs is analyzed in order to develop reservoir more efficiently. The result shows that the effect of horizontal well on curb water coning is limited , the limit recovery efficiency of it is lower than that of vertical well , and the stimulation treatments for it are difficult to be carried out . It concludes that horizontal wells are not suitable for bottom water reservoir development , but advantageous for edge water reservoirs with thin layer , low permeability and heavy oil .
